The smallest variety in the world, developed by the University of Florida, USA, introduced in 1989. It is a cross between "Florida basket" and "Ohio".

Cherry-like fruit, red with a possible tip, +/- 10 grams and +/- 2 cm diameter, clusters of +/- 10 units.

Sweet flavour.

To be cultivated for its decorative interest, in pots or in suspension.

nb: according to Vents marins this is a hybrid variety!
